    The bubble has burst

    • Level: 17
    • Small Blind: 5K
    • Big Blind: 10K
    • Button Ante: 5K
    • Chip Average: 202K
    • Remaining: 22
    • Entries: 178

    2018/07/31 - 1:08 by Jôle Simard

    When the field dropped to 24 players, the 5th table broke, and play was halted to give time to the movers. Players were then scattered on 4 tables of 6 and playing hand for hand, waiting for 1 bust to make the money.

    Patrick St-Onge, just before the table break, managed to double his rather short stack with 7 of Clubs 7 of Spades after shoving all-in and getting called by Sébastien Proulx’s King of Hearts 10 of Spades on the big blind. You can see St-Onge’s incomprehension in the photo below. St-Onge is still nagging Proulx about the call, in a friendly way of course.

    During hand-for-hand play, François Tarrab folded both his blinds and paid the button ante, keeping 1.5K in the hope that another table produces a bust. His wish was granted! Nick Frascarelli and Jonathan Bussières got it in on a neighbouring table.

    Frascarelli: Jack of Spades 10 of Diamonds
    Bussières: Ace of Clubs 10 of Clubs

    Board: 8 of Diamonds Ace of Spades King of Hearts 6 of Spades 4 of Spades
